‘Confronting the past’: A conversation with a former human trafficker
Anti-trafficking advocate and director of HOPE Against Trafficking, Chrissy Hemphill sits down with an ex-trafficker, Burron Pittman.
They have a candid conversation about both sides of the issue. While they discover some similarities, they realize that some things are still difficult to see eye-to-eye on.
